Library loan
Ensure the copy exists in inventory, issue it to the correct borrower, track the open loan, then return it.
Steps
- Inventory - Inventory
- Confirm the title/copy is catalogued and available before issue.
- Tip: do not issue a copy that is already on loan. Fix inventory first if the status looks wrong.


- Issue - Issue / Return
- Select the learner (or staff borrower), select the copy, set due date, then issue.
- Tip: wrong learner at issue is hard to unwind after the book leaves the desk. Confirm admission number/name twice.


- Borrow records - Borrow Records
- Filter open loans, overdue, or by borrower to chase returns.
- Tip: use printouts from Printouts when you need a paper overdue list.


- Return
- On Issue / Return, locate the open loan and mark returned.
- Tip: returning without clearing the open record leaves the copy blocked for the next borrower.
Role handoff
Librarian (or Admin) runs inventory, issue, records, and return. Teachers/students may browse catalogue screens where enabled; they do not post loans.
Common mistakes
- Issuing a copy already on loan
- Wrong learner selected at issue
- Skipping inventory and inventing a barcode at the desk
- Leaving overdue loans uncleared in Borrow Records
